怎么把div固定在一個(gè)位置 HTML5如何才能讓導(dǎo)航欄固定頂部不動(dòng),且!且!且!不遮擋住下面的DIV?
HTML5如何才能讓導(dǎo)航欄固定頂部不動(dòng),且!且!且!不遮擋住下面的DIV?在兩層之間添加此選項(xiàng),其中的高度可以設(shè)置為所需的高度。CSS:空白{清除:兩個(gè)都溢出:隱藏顯示:塊溢出為了達(dá)到這個(gè)效果,我們需
HTML5如何才能讓導(dǎo)航欄固定頂部不動(dòng),且!且!且!不遮擋住下面的DIV?
在兩層之間添加此選項(xiàng),其中的高度可以設(shè)置為所需的高度。CSS:空白{清除:兩個(gè)都溢出:隱藏顯示:塊溢出為了達(dá)到這個(gè)效果,我們需要使用固定定位。具體方法是先打開HTML編輯器,先設(shè)置一個(gè)容器div,然后設(shè)置一個(gè)用于演示效果的div,并設(shè)置名為container和fixed的類屬性:[2]在樣式標(biāo)簽中設(shè)置樣式,將容器的position屬性設(shè)置為相對(duì)定位,并給它一個(gè)高的高度,然后設(shè)置高度,寬度、顏色等屬性要固定這里的關(guān)鍵點(diǎn)是將位置屬性設(shè)置為固定,并設(shè)置頂部和左側(cè)屬性來(lái)控制Div的位置。設(shè)置完成后,保存文件:
3。打開瀏覽器,可以看到div和進(jìn)度條的頂部:
4。然后把進(jìn)度條拉到底,你會(huì)發(fā)現(xiàn)div仍然在原來(lái)的位置。上面是用固定屬性設(shè)置div的固定位置的方法:
css div固定一個(gè)div使這個(gè)div不隨著網(wǎng)頁(yè)的滾而滾動(dòng),就是把這個(gè)div固定在一個(gè)位置任何時(shí)候都在一個(gè)位置?
我不知道主體說(shuō)了什么樣的不動(dòng)
生成絕對(duì)定位元素并將其從文檔流中分離
具體的位置調(diào)整是使用top、left、right、bottom或margin
適用于:floating廣告,浮動(dòng)菜單,
2。絕對(duì)
絕對(duì)定位也是從文檔流中分離出來(lái)的,相對(duì)于第一個(gè)位置不是靜態(tài)的父元素。您還可以通過(guò)“上”、“左”、“右”、“下”和“邊距”來(lái)調(diào)整位置
將內(nèi)容固定到特定位置并相對(duì)于瀏覽器窗口定位。
定位位置通常有絕對(duì)定位和相對(duì)定位,它們都是相對(duì)于主體中的塊元素。但是,如果要在某個(gè)位置設(shè)置某個(gè)內(nèi)容,無(wú)論滾動(dòng)條滑動(dòng)到何處,它仍然在瀏覽器窗口中,需要使用固定的。
固定元素框的行為類似于將位置設(shè)置為絕對(duì),但其包含的塊是窗口本身。同意使用left、top、right和bottom的值。它的用法類似于絕對(duì)
有關(guān)詳細(xì)信息,請(qǐng)參閱W3C中的說(shuō)明。